Kozybayev University Took Part in the First Regional Digital Forum Digital Qyzyljar

At the Qyzyljar Creative Center, a number of IT and creative projects were presented, including student and school startup initiatives, educational platforms, as well as existing digital products.

Among them was the Center for Artificial Intelligence and Digital Transformation of Kozybayev University. Its main goal is to automate processes in order to simplify interaction and foster the development of social sectors, the economy, and business.

“Despite the fact that we only opened on November 3, we already have 8 projects we are working on. One example is a project to automate the timetable creation process, making it more convenient for students and teachers to move between buildings. Another project is an AI ticket system for automating requests. In addition, together with students from Arizona, we are developing automated detection of product defects based on data samples from the company Raduga using AI,” said Gulnara Kim, Director of the Center for AI and Digital Transformation.

The Chairman of the Executive Board – Rector Yerbol Issakayev also spoke at the forum. He noted that today, within the country’s digital ecosystem, universities play a key role - they are becoming centers of expertise, experimental platforms, and innovation.

Kozybayev University is also carrying out systematic work to train a new generation of specialists and to integrate artificial intelligence into educational, managerial, and business processes.

At present, 659 students are studying in IT programs, including 190 in a dual-degree program with the University of Arizona. Of these, 22 students are currently studying in the United States.

Already in this academic year, students are implementing several projects:

  1. Development of a system for automatic detection of product defects based on production data and ML analysis for the company Raduga;
  2. Development of a diagnostic model for assessing the risk of cardiovascular diseases using classification algorithms;
  3. Development of a predictive IT system for forecasting students’ academic performance based on educational metrics, among others.

“Kozybayev University has become the key university of the country for the implementation of the AI Sana program—a national project for the development of artificial intelligence. Today, it is among the top 10 universities and ranks first in the country in terms of the number of students who have completed basic AI courses on platforms such as Huawei, Coursera, and Astana Hub. This is a significant achievement, with more than 11,000 certificates obtained. Five AI agents have been developed for advancing education, transportation, healthcare, and internal analytics. These projects are not just academic prototypes—they are already being implemented in the digital ecosystem of the university and the region,” said Yerbol Issakayev.

The university is also launching KU AI School—an artificial intelligence school where students and high schoolers will learn machine learning skills, web development, and neural network integration. The outcome of this training will be the creation of their own intelligent application—from concept to a viable product.

Today, Kozybayev University is not just training specialists. It is building a regional AI ecosystem, where the university serves as a center of synergy for local executive bodies, business, and science. It is here that solutions are born that can scale to the national level tomorrow.
